Output d66d7e9dad8434ad12668be9efa6e6e45211ff716b8eea8065b6088545641dc6:1

value
2629941719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a374cb69a451d420b8fc3c5cabb64f23e4e50a9f OP_EQUAL
address
3GbHyqnE1BitP6m4VkSZFDjaBMiHGWDTv5
transaction
d66d7e9dad8434ad12668be9efa6e6e45211ff716b8eea8065b6088545641dc6
spent
true